A young emcee catapulted from the underground to fame beyond his wildest dreams, Mac Miller pretty much has it all—or he would, if it weren’t for the absence of a certain female from his life. Missed Calls, the latest single off Miller’s blockbuster debut set, finds the emcee wistfully reflecting on the disintegration of a relationship over a poignant piano beat by Rittz Reynolds. Official visuals come courtesy of director Ian Wolfson. Fans can find this record and much more on Miller’s Blue Slide Park LP, available in stores and online as of fall 2011.
